
Singer Lee Chan-won reunited with his hometown friends of 12 years on the variety show "Fun-staurant." He brought laughter to viewers as he reacted with embarrassment to past photos that bordered on being his "dark history."
“Aren’t you the Student Dean?”... Friends’ Ruthless Roasts During the broadcast, Lee's friends revealed a collection of his high school photos. In the pictures, Lee looked youthful but wore thick glasses that covered half his face—a far cry from his current polished look. His unique fashion sense, particularly his habit of wearing suits as a teenager, became a hot topic. Looking at a photo of him at a baseball stadium in a full suit, his friends joked, “What high schooler looks like the Head of Student Affairs?”
Lee Chan-won’s Candid Confession... “It was a bit much” Though initially flustered, Lee Chan-won carefully examined the photos and eventually bowed his head, admitting, “Honestly, even from my perspective, this was a bit much.” At the time, he weighed only 52kg. He coolly acknowledged that his mature way of speaking—learned from living with his grandmother—combined with his suit-heavy style, made him look much older than his peers.
The Dignity of a ‘Trot Prodigy’ Hidden Behind the Dowdiness While his appearance might have earned him the nickname “Student Dean,” his inner talent was extraordinary. His friends shared videos of his “prodigy” days when he confidently sang trot and played the piano in front of 1,700 students. Expert Pyo Chang-won analyzed, “There is immense confidence in the eyes behind those glasses,” emphasizing that despite his outward appearance, Lee was a student with great inner strength.
